    The asymptotic behaviour of solutions of nonlinear parabolic equations on unbounded domains is studied. In order to compensate the lack of compactness in the Sobolev imbedding, a time-dependent weight is introduced, which becomes effective for large times. The existence of a global attractor is then proved for several examples, and the finite fractal dimensionality of this attractor is established.
